Fire Crews Respond to Cell Fire at HMP Thameside

Thamesmead, London — Emergency fire crews were called to HMP Thameside on Griffin Manor Way this afternoon following reports of a fire breaking out in a cell.

The incident occurred during lunchtime, prompting a swift response from fire crews who accessed the prison . Prison staff ensured the crews were met and guided upon arrival to the affected area.

Response and Containment

Details regarding the cause of the fire remain unclear, but initial reports indicate that it was contained to a single cell. Firefighters worked quickly to extinguish the flames, and no injuries have been reported at this stage.

Prison authorities are working alongside the London Fire Brigade to assess the extent of the damage and investigate the circumstances surrounding the incident.

Safety Measures

A spokesperson for the prison service stated:

“We can confirm that a fire occurred in a cell at HMP Thameside. The situation has been brought under control thanks to the swift actions of our staff and the fire crews. Safety remains our top priority, and an investigation is underway.”

Investigation Ongoing

Authorities are expected to conduct a thorough review of the fire, including whether it was accidental or deliberate. No further disruption to prison operations has been reported.
